Explain the Mucous Membrane
This layer is lined by the epithelial cells. Parts of the tract which are subject to mechanical injury, the layer consists of stratified squamous epithelium. Parts of the tract which secrete digestive juice and absorb food materials, the layer consists of columnar epithelium. This layer has three main functions - protective, secretory and absorptive.
